Nevada Has No Income Tax — Here's What $4,112,811 Takes Home
Nevada levies no state income tax, so a $4,112,811 salary nets $2,533,831 — only federal income tax and FICA apply. Combined effective rate: 38.4%.
Full Tax Breakdown — $4,112,811 in Nevada (Single Filer)
| Tax Item | Amount | Rate |
|---|---|---|
| Gross Salary | $4,112,811 | — |
| Federal Income Tax | − $1,473,210 | 35.8% |
| Social Security (6.2%) | − $10,918 | 0.3% |
| Medicare (1.45%+) | − $94,851 | 2.3% |
| Total Taxes | − $1,578,980 | 38.4% |
| Take-Home Pay | $2,533,831 | 61.6% |

Nevada Tax Overview
Nevada levies no state income tax on wages, putting it among 9 states that leave that portion of the tax burden entirely to the federal government. That makes NV especially attractive to high earners — a $150,000 salary keeps roughly $8,000 more annually than a comparable earner in a 5% flat-rate state. No local income taxes apply in most jurisdictions.
